Gastritis
Gastritis and duodenitis are two common, related gastrointestinal conditions that tend to occur together, when the lining of the stomach and duodenum (the first part of the small intestine) is damaged, leading to inflammation.

Signs & Symptoms of Gastritis
Such inflammation, in our experience, is signaled by a cluster of symptoms that includes:
- Abdominal pain that can become worse or better after eating
- A recurrent upset stomach, indigestion
- Abdominal bloating
- Belching and gas
- Nausea, vomiting
- Constipation and diarrhea
- Loss of appetite
Left untreated, long-term gastro-intestinal inflammation can also lead to:
- Anemia
- Gastrointestinal ulcers
- Sleep disturbances
- Emotional imbalances
Causes of Gastritis
The most common cause that we encounter in our patients by far is exposure to the bacteria H. Pylori. Many other emotional and lifestyle factors, however, can also lead to chronic inflammation or leave the body more vulnerable to infectious agents, increasing the risk of developing symptoms. These include:
- The frequent use of certain painkillers
- Strong alcohol
- Chronic stress
- A diet rich in fried and processed foods
- Smoking
